The first thing to do is make sure your Audi has a transponder chip. This chip is the unique password for your vehicle, making it harder to copy and compromise its security. The chips are designed for long-term use, but they are able to be replaced by a locksmith in the event that they fail.

Traditional keys are simple metal key fobs that require manual inserting and turning to start your car. While these are becoming less common in newer Audi models and some drivers may still make use of them as backups for older vehicles. In these situations, a locksmith can copy the key's shell at less than a dealer charges. Locksmiths can also salvage a broken transponder chip and reuse it in the form of a new key, saving you even more money.

Many people do not keep spare keys in a safe location. The good thing is that it's fairly simple to replace your key if you lose it. You can do this by contacting the dealership or local locksmiths. They can usually offer you the replacement quicker and at lower cost.

You can purchase an OEM key from an Audi dealer for between $280 and $450 They may also charge an additional fee to program the key. Locksmiths are generally less expensive and has more flexibility with regards to the time it takes to make a replacement key.
